Honey-Soy Salmon with Creamy Sriracha Sauce
Serves | 4-6 |
Meal type | Main Dish |
Website | Sriracha sauce adapted from Prevention RD |
Ingredients
Salmon
- 1 Pound salmon
- 2 Tbsp honey
- 1 Tbsp soy sauce
Sauce
- 3 Tbsp low fat mayo
- 3 Tbsp Greek yogurt
- 1/2 Tsp soy sauce
- juice of 1/2 a lime
- 1 Tbsp sriracha
Note
This creamy and spicy sriracha sauce is also delicious on chicken, tofu, or as a dip for vegetables. You can scale back on the sriracha if it's too spicy or add a bit more if it's not spicy enough.
Directions
Salmon | |
1. | Preheat oven to 425 and line a baking sheet with parchment or aluminum foil sprayed with cooking spray. |
2. | In a small bowl, combine honey and soy sauce. Place salmon in a shallow dish and pour honey-soy mixture over top. Let marinade in the fridge for at least 30 minutes. |
3. | Remove from fridge and place on lined baking sheet skin side down. Bake for about 12 minutes until salmon is cooked through (may be a little more or less depending on the thickness of the salmon). |
Sauce | |
4. | Combine all ingredients in a small bowl and set aside. |
